The Manchester tribute flag you’re seeing all over the Internet was created by an artist who never signed off on his work being used by millions of people … for free, mind you — and yet he’s not pissed.
Mark E. Tisdale, who’s American, tells TMZ he created the original art back in 2013. He was surprised to see it become such a uniting symbol for the Manchester tragedy … posted by tons of people, including David Beckham.
Mark says, obviously, he didn’t design the flag years ago with tragedy in mind. However, in light of the bombing … he’s glad it’s being used to help bring people together on social media.
And while his art’s mostly being spread without crediting him … he says he has gotten a lot more traffic on his website where he sells his digital art.
Mark’s planning to donate any dough he makes off the Manchester flag to relief efforts.
